Spontaneous dissociation of phosphoniumylidyl-chlorophosphines to ionic phosphenium chlorides
Schmidpeter, Alfred,Jochem, Georg
, p. 471 - 474 (2007/10/02)
The products from the replacement of two chlorofunctions of PCl3 by a pair of phosphoniumylidyl substituents or by both a phosphoniumylidyl and an amino substituent are ionic phosphenium chlorides and not covalent chlorophosphines.
